It should fill us with joy, that infinite wisdom guides the affairs of the world. Many of its events are shrouded in darkness and mystery, and inextricable confusion sometimes seems to reign. Often wickedness prevails, and God seems to have forgotten the creatures that He has made. Our own path through life is dark and devious, and beset with difficulties and dangers. How full of consolation is the doctrine, that infinite wisdom directs every event, brings order out of confusion, and light out of darkness, and, to those who love God, causes all things, whatever be their present aspect and apparent tendency, to work together for good.
J.L. Dagg

Bean and Beef Soup

0
(0)
CATEGORY CUISINE TAG YIELD
Grains, Meats Soups/stews 1 Servings

INGREDIENTS

1 lb Navy beans
1 lb Prunes
1 qt Cut carrots
1 1/2 qt Cut potatoes
1 lb Beef stew meat
1 Onion
Salt and pepper
12 Whole cloves

INSTRUCTIONS

Soak 1 pound navy beans overnight. Cook beans, prunes,
beef and vegetables separately. Do not drain. Mix all
together and simmer until the flavors are mixed.
